Investing.com -- Nuvalent Inc (NASDAQ:NUVL) stock fell 3.6% in Monday premarket trading after the clinical-stage biopharmaceutical company released topline pivotal data for its investigational ...
Beneficient (NASDAQ: BENF) ("Ben" or the "Company"), a technology-enabled platform providing exit opportunities and primary capital solutions and related trust 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results